WebThe short-stay calculator is used to calculate the amount of time available for short stays of no more than 90 days in any 180-day period. This calculator is used for third-state nationals within the Schengen Area, regardless of their visa obligation status. The short-stay calculator was developed by the European Commission and the Norwegian ... WebA Moving Target: How to Calculate the 180 Days. Calculating the 90 days is fairly straightforward, but where the most confusion arises is the rolling 180-day period. It’s often easiest to think of this 180-days as a moving block of time that is counted backwards from each day of staying in the Schengen Area.
